Statement is not in a valid name space..

Status
Niet open voor verdere reacties.

Jereun

Nieuwe gebruiker
Lid geworden
27 dec 2008
Berichten
1
Hallo,

Ik heb een velleman usb kaartje (K8055) gekocht, en deze wil ik aansturen met behulp van een programma dat in VB geschreven is.
Het kaartje werkt met een bijgeleverd DLL file.

Nu heb ik al een begin gemaakt maar ik krijg elke keer de melding "Statement is not in a valid name space"

Het DLL file moet ik in de map system32 plaatsen, en daar staat die ook.
Ik heb al van alles geprobeerd maar ik hou die error's. (18 stuks) Graag zou ik willen weten hoe ik dit oplos (zodat ik de opdracht build gebruiken kan).
Een voorbeeld:

Private Declare Function OpenDevice Lib "k8055d.dll" (Byval Cardaddress as Integer) As Integer.

De "k8055d.dll" is dus het probleem.
Wie kan mij helpen?
Ik werk met VB Express Edition 2008

Vriendelijke groet,

Jeroen
 
volgens mij staat die declaratie niet op de goede plek. Hij moet binnen de class en buiten de subs en functies staan. En je moet boven die declaratie zetten :
Code:
Inherits System.Windows.Forms.Form
 
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an